Frank Lloyd Wright’s architectural legacy is deeply embedded in the history of American design, and his use of stained glass is a particularly captivating aspect of his work. His influence can even be felt in Colorado Springs, where his distinct style continues to inspire both art aficionados and homeowners alike. Wright designed approximately 4,500 leaded glass windows for about 150 buildings he architected, emphasizing the critical role these installations played in his overarching architectural vision.

Exploring Wright’s Geometric Genius

Wright was renowned for utilizing geometric shapes in his stained glass, effectively combining mathematical principles with artistic flair to create stunning patterns. His approach was revolutionary; instead of seeing stained glass as mere window decor, he treated it as an integral architectural component, akin to Japanese shoji screens. The Craftsmanship Behind Wright’s Stained Glass

Creating one of Wright’s stained glass pieces involved a meticulous process. It started with drawing a full-size pattern on paper, known as a cartoon. Individual paper pieces were then cut and used as templates for glass cutting. The glass pieces were joined using metal strips, or came, and finally installed within a frame through soldering. This complex and careful method highlights the labor intensity and the artistry involved in producing these stunning windows.

  • **Robie House:** Located in Chicago, Illinois, this home features some of Wright’s most iconic stained glass windows, characterized by bold geometric patterns and a play on light and shadow.
  • **Unity Temple:** Another Illinois gem, the Unity Temple’s windows were crafted to evoke spiritual transcendence, making use of abstract shapes that resonate with the natural environment.
  • **Darwin D. Martin House:** In Buffalo, New York, this example showcases intricate windows that marry organic patterns with architectural harmony, a hallmark of Wright’s work.

Why Choose Frank Lloyd Wright Stained Glass?

Wright’s stained glass designs hold immense appeal due to their intrinsic balance of form and function. By employing an array of colorful and clear glass, often accented with gold leaf, Wright’s windows captivate and transform spaces by manipulating light. This characteristic makes his work timeless, offering both aesthetic and practical improvements to a range of architectural settings.
